Course page for CS1010 - Discrete Mathematics for Computer Science

Syllabus:

Proof techniques, logic, counting, growth of functions, recurrences, probability, number theory, graph theory and other topics.

Resources:

How to write mathematics - A guide by Martin Erickson
Lecture Notes on Mathematics for Computer Science by Eric Lehman, Thomson Leighton and Albert Meyer
[Also see the 2004 version of the MFCS notes.]

Assignments

Assignment 1
Assignment 2
Assignment 3
Assignment 4
Assignment 5
Practice problems for Mid-sem: Click here

Division of credit:

Attendance: 10%, Assignments: 15%, Quizzes: 20%, Midsem: 25%, Endsem: 30%

Academic Honesty Policy